Definitions
- the invention relates to a device and a method for fastening tooth models to the articulator or a similar device.
- the occlusal surfaces of the dentures are matched to a patient's temporomandibular joint in order to be able to integrate the dentures into the dentition without problems.
- Articulators should make it possible to reproduce the jaw movements of a patient and thus optimally adapt the dentures.
- the tooth models to be adjusted in the articulator must have the same spatial orientation to the joints of the articulator as the rows of teeth of a patient to his jaw joint in order to be able to approximately reproduce the jaw movements of a patient.
- the tooth models of the upper and lower jaw rows are plastered onto model carrier plates, which are attached to the upper and lower parts of the articulator.
- a bite fork is first inserted into the articulator with the upper part of the articulator open, on which the upper jaw model is placed. Then plaster is applied to the base of the upper jaw model and the articulator upper part, which is provided with a model carrier plate, is lowered onto the still moist plaster. After the plaster has hardened on the upper jaw model, the articulator is turned upside down and the position of the lower jaw model is aligned with the upper jaw model.
- the tooth models of the upper and lower jaw teeth row on the bite fork, the jaw axis, the intersection between the front incisors and the chewing plane of a patient indicates that they are precisely aligned, since a subsequent correction is no longer possible.
- a particular problem here is the swelling of the gypsum by about 1% when it hardens, so that the exact adjustment does not remain.
- the object of the invention is to provide a device and a method for attaching tooth models to the articulator or a similar device which, while avoiding the disadvantages mentioned, enables linear and circular adjustment of a tooth model in a vertical and horizontal articulator enables, the adjustment can be easily reproduced at any time.
- An advantage of the device according to the invention is that the tooth model can be brought into any desired position within the articulator by adjustment using the adjusting screws. After it is attached to the connecting plate, the tooth model is first brought into the correct position in relation to the bite fork and thus the correct position in the articulator by turning the vertical adjustment screws in the vertical and in the inclination and then by turning the horizontal adjustment screws in the horizontal. It is not necessary to open the upper or lower part of the articulator.
- the position of the tooth model set in this way via the vertical and horizontal adjustment screws can expediently be read off on scales which are attached to the adjustment screws.
- the desired position of the tooth models of the upper and lower jaw tooth rows in the articulator can thus be reproduced quickly and easily at any time after reading and storing the scale information and resetting the read scale information on the vertical and horizontal adjustment screws.
- This enables a more flexible use of an articulator, which means that several tooth models can be processed on one articulator.
- Protective caps made of elastic material are expediently attachable to the adjusting screws in order to avoid inadvertent adjustment of the positioning.
- a magnet embedded in the connecting plate of the device with a corresponding counterpart in the base of a tooth model and, on the other hand, projections of the connecting plate of the device according to the invention engaging in recesses in the base of a tooth model are used.
- These fasteners enable a firm, non-twistable and plaster-free connection between the tooth model and the device, which can be quickly and easily made and released again.
- the connecting plate of the device according to the invention corresponding to the model carrier plate of conventional articulators therefore advantageously does not remain on the tooth model, as is the case with conventionally permanently connected, namely, plastered tooth models.

- an articulator frame with an articulator upper part 1 and an articulator lower part 2 is shown.
- a base plate 101 is fastened to the upper and lower part 1, 2 of the articulator with a centrally located locking screw 3, in which three adjustment screws 102 are guided perpendicularly.
- Another intermediate plate 105 is arranged horizontally displaceably on the intermediate plate 103 by means of a further adjusting screw 104, the displacement taking place in the longitudinal axis direction of the upper and lower parts 1, 2 of the articulator.
- a further intermediate plate 107 is arranged horizontally displaceably by a further adjusting screw 106 extending at right angles to the adjusting screw 104, this intermediate plate 107 being displaceable at right angles to the longitudinal axis direction of the upper and lower part 1, 2 of the articulator.
- a connecting plate 109 is mounted on the intermediate plate 107 and can be rotated about a vertical axis by an eccentrically arranged adjusting screw 108.
- FIG. 1 shows that a magnet 111 is inserted in the center of the connecting plate 109, which is arranged opposite a magnetic counterplate 8 inserted in the base of a tooth model 7.
- projections 110 engage in correspondingly shaped recesses in the base of a tooth model 7.
